Scheduling in Climbing Hill, IA

To arrange a DOT drug or alcohol test in Climbing Hill, contact our local scheduling team at (800) 221-4291 or utilize our online express scheduling to select your test and complete the Donor Info section before visiting the center.

The zip code provided helps identify the nearest testing site in Climbing Hill, IA. A donor pass with location details will be sent to your email. Bring this with you; appointments are usually not required. Complete donor info and payment during registration.

Our SAMHSA-certified labs ensure accurate results verified by in-house licensed Medical Review Officers (MRO).
